NVIDIA launched DLSS 4.5 in the Nvidia app beta, introducing a 6x Multi Frame Generation mode for RTX 50-series GPUs that generates five additional frames for every single natively rendered frame (up from a max of three in DLSS 4). The update also includes a new DLSS Frame Generation Model for RTX 40 and 50 series to improve in-game UIs, Dynamic Frame Generation for automated switching of generation levels, and adds DLSS 4.5 Super Resolution support for ARC Raiders and Marvel Rivals among over 20 supported titles. Nvidia says responsiveness impact is minimal; rollout begins today via the app beta.
This release shifts the competition from pure silicon performance to a software-driven perceived-performance moat, which can raise effective ARPU per GPU without materially changing wafer demand in the near term. That amplifies pricing power for the incumbent at the high end and creates a durable differentiation vector that competitors must integrate or counter—middleware and engine-level adoption will determine who captures the bulk of long-term share. Expect a two-speed adoption curve: immediate engagement from enthusiast and cloud-gaming segments that chase responsiveness/visual upgrades, and a multi-quarter cadence for broad studio and middleware integration that drives real upgrade cycles. That means meaningful revenue/volume inflection points are more likely to show in semiconductor and board OEM results 2–6 quarters out rather than within the next reporting period. Second-order supply effects favor foundry and high-bandwidth memory suppliers as shift toward higher-ASP cards increases demand for premium silicon and memory stacks; conversely, mid-cycle used-GPU volume could rise and temporarily compress prices on older models, pressuring OEM channel margins. Key near-term risks: software regressions, visible UI/artifact issues, or negative benchmarks that could stall consumer enthusiasm and force feature rollback—these are binary events capable of reversing sentiment in days. Strategically, this is as much a platform-play as a product one: the winner will be the vendor that converts short-term feature wins into developer tooling, licensing, and cloud partnerships. Monitor engineering partnerships, engine plugins, and first-party game integrations as the leading indicators that this will translate into durable financial upside rather than a transient marketing advantage.
